Bush Replacement in Ventura County, CA
Bush replacement services involve removing existing shrubbery and installing new bushes to enhance the appearance and value of residential properties. These projects typically include replacing overgrown, damaged, or outdated bushes with healthier, more suitable varieties. Homeowners often request bush replacement when they want to improve curb appeal, manage landscape design, or address issues caused by pests, disease, or weather damage. It is helpful to consider the types of bushes that thrive in the local climate and how the new plantings will complement existing landscape features before requesting this service.
Property owners should understand the scope of bush replacement, including site preparation, plant selection, and ongoing maintenance requirements. Proper planning ensures that the new bushes will grow healthily and maintain their aesthetic appeal over time. Additionally, considering the placement, size, and growth habits of the new shrubs can help achieve a balanced and attractive landscape. Clarifying these details beforehand can support a smooth replacement process and help meet long-term landscaping goals.

Bush Replacement Questions
What are common signs that a bush needs replacement? Signs include persistent dieback, extensive root damage, or outdated varieties that no longer suit the landscape.
How does replacing a bush improve property appearance? Replacing overgrown or unhealthy bushes can enhance curb appeal and create a more inviting outdoor space.
What types of bushes are suitable for replacement projects? Popular options include native shrubs, flowering varieties, and low-maintenance plants tailored to the local climate.
Is bush replacement suitable for small or large landscaping updates? Bush replacement can be part of both minor refreshes and major landscape redesigns to improve overall property aesthetics.
